peace like a river


there is sometimes a claustrophobic bubble of tense smallness in my chest; i am particularly aware of its presence when the pace of the last few years of my life leaves me little room to sit back and pause to catch my breath. in that awful smallness i am aware of how fragile and fleeting the present is. i am also aware of how fixed the past is and how intenable and inscrutable the future is as it stalwartly frustrates all my feverish attempts to pry security to cling onto. my small hands cannot reach back and fiddle with the past; my small hands are too small to carry the weight of the present; my small hands cannot reach into the dark of the future to get any answers.

it is in this visceral "fear of smallness" and lack of control and direction that i find that i must direct my thoughts to the only Person worthy of my attention, energy, and hope. in this buzzing fear i am also aware of a God who holds my whole life in his hands: his presence was threaded through the fabric of my past, is a working force in my present regardless of the level of my awareness, and is promised reassurance for all of my future. i don't have to change the past because he has written it that way; i don't have to carry the present because he holds it for me, and i don't have to foresee the future because he will orchestrate it. as i meditate upon his worthiness of my trust, my emotions will align with the steadying nature of this truth. this, i suppose, is what it means to have peace like a river. give me battered and bruised and ugly knees as i use the transformative power of conversation with my Father to turn that claustrophobic bubble into a house of refuge and sanctuary. it is his presence in this bubble that transforms it. with him as the object of my faith i may content myself with being small in this moving river because he is my peace. whom shall i fear?
